Output 5998620c29f7a151eab15a71040b390dd7a9094270f1fbe4edb7003125e071df:4

value
1502632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d8307f9f9e490b8b76c7fbe64936861f2f75b2 OP_EQUAL
address
37nTWJyTaBa1fequ1i8iLS9SPkFeBtQjvx
transaction
5998620c29f7a151eab15a71040b390dd7a9094270f1fbe4edb7003125e071df
spent
true